P-P-P-Poker Face
Shuffling furtively onto Qi's high-scoring deck of games this week with an 8.5 rating is Zynga Poker, which gives iPhone-wielding Texas hold 'em fans ample opportunity to excuse themselves from the office to play a quick round in the john.
Not content with taking over Facebook (and therefore the world), FarmVille's creator is slowly spreading its influence over the App Store, helped in no small measure by this slick and popular - six million players, ja - poker experience.
Dont worry if your mates 'only' own an iPad, though, as 148Apps points out: "The best part of the app...is really its Facebook integration. Thanks to it, gamers can easily play with their Facebook friends from whatever iOS device they choose."
Battlefield Warfare: iPhone Ops
If outgunning rather than outbluffing is more your bag, then Deadlock: Online, the new dual-stick shooter from New York-based Crescent Moon Games, may tickle your (somewhat violent) pickle.
Deadlock: Online attempts to bring the fast-paced, rewards-heavy multiplayer thrills of console FPS games to the humble iPhone for less than a pint of milk.
Thats right: sweet, sweet nowt.
And according to Pocket Gamer, Crescent Moon largely succeeds, "Its pleasing to see a developer take the genre in a slightly different but entirely satisfying direction.
"Deadlock: Onlines lack of a price tag makes it a no-brainer: you simply have nothing to lose by giving this unique shooter a try."
